STUDY WITH THE VIEW TO DEVELOPING RATIONAL TECHNOLOGICAL PROCEDURES FOR THE PRODUCTION OF ESSENTIAL OIL FROM STAR ANISE FRUIT,

Abstract

Methods for the production of essential oil of the fruit of star anise by steam distillation were studied with the view to developing a satisfactory technological process. The effects of the degree of disintegration of the fruit on the yield of oil, the length of time of distillation, and the amount of steam used were determined. A procedure is proposed whereby steam distillation is first carried out at atmospheric pressure and than at a higher pressure (2--6 atm) or with superheated steam. (Author)
